ASUS releases Z590 chipset motherboard series for 11th generation Intel core processors

ASUS Korea Co., Ltd., the Korean branch of ASUS (Director: In-Seok Kang, hereinafter referred to as’Asus’), officially announced Intel Z590 chipset motherboard products corresponding to Intel’s new 11th generation core processor (codename Rocket Lake) in Korea. .

Designed to maximize the performance of 11th generation Intel processors, Asus Z590 series motherboards are designed for consumers who always want the best, ROG MAXIMUS XIII series, ROG series with various gaming functions, and TUF series with strong durability and gaming. It is prepared as an optimized PRIME series.

It maximizes the convenience and performance optimized for the system, including’AI Overclocking’,’AI Cooling’, and’AI Networking’, the representative AI technologies of Asus. It also supports up to 16 lanes of PCI Express 4.0 connection, which provides up to 32GB/s of bandwidth for high-performance discrete GPUs, and uses four dedicated PCIe 4.0 lanes in the processor to provide the best SSD performance.

ROG Maximus XIII series supports high performance and more stable overclocking with superior performance and efficient integrated power stage. In particular, ROG Maximus XIII Extreme is taking power delivery technology to the next level with a redesigned multiphase VRM with an 18+2 topology.

One of Asus’ most powerful motherboards, the ROG Maximus XIII Extreme Glacial boasts improved performance in all areas of power and cooling. Designed with top-of-the-line Maximus XIII Extreme PCB, Extreme Glacial is fully water-cooled through a full-coverage water block developed in collaboration with EK’s experts, including VRM, storage, and Z590 platform controller hubs for maximum performance and lowest temperatures in game builds. ROG Maximus XIII Extreme and Maximus XIII Extreme Glacial further enhance cooling performance and RGB LED control. The new ROG fan controller module includes six pairs of addressable RGB and 4-pin fan headers that integrate with Fan Xpert, Aura Sync for precise control in a 2.5-inch form factor that can be easily mounted on the system, and two thermal sensor headers. Also included, strengthened the monitoring function. It offers up to two onboard Thunderbolt 4 USB Type-C ports. It fully supports the next generation USB4 protocol, providing up to 40 Gbps of bandwidth over a cable length of up to 2 meters.

The ROG and ROG Strix Z590 series use the new Realtek ALC4000 series audio codec to deliver the highest quality sound in any environment, including music and games. By combining the next-generation audio codec and ESS digital-to-analog converter, you can enjoy the purest sound with hi-fi headphones. In addition, SupremeFX circuit design and software provide a satisfying hi-fi gaming and listening experience.

Powered by a thorough investigation and characterization of the performance of thousands of real CPUs in a test lab, AI Overclocking provides overclocking performance and high ease of use. It can handle both lightly threaded workloads and full core workloads with one click, boosting the CPU clock. In addition, it monitors the efficiency of the CPU cooler and changes in the system operating environment to maintain the system at optimal performance.

The two-way AI noise canceling feature removes background noise from microphones and other audio sources, allowing you to hear clearer sound in games and group chats. AI Cooling integrates information about the system’s fan and component temperatures to automatically achieve the best balance between cooling performance and noise level. And AI Networking ensures that the right traffic always has priority. These AI-based features are supported by the ROG Maximus XIII and ROG Strix Z590 series. TUF Gaming and Prime series also support some AI functions.
